Re: PS5 Fans Divided on PlayStation Portal Handheld

TheElectroFunky

And I would like to point out, despite some stating it will be the case the Portal can connect direct to the PS5 without the need to bunny hop on home wifi, when in range, there’s no documentation on that at all.

https://www.playstation.com/en-us/accessories/playstation-portal-remote-player/#:~:text=PlayStation%20Portal™%20Remote%20Player%20can%20stream%20compatible%20games%20installed,at%20least%2015Mbps%20is%20recommended.

Everything including the small print and FAQ refers to the need of either a home WiFi or a public/private none home one.

At no point is it mentioned it will create a direct ad-hoc connection to the two devices when in range.

So if that is the case and they do indeed use that, which would be much preferred, they’ve clearly forgotten to mention it.
